Claims (17)

  1. 그 위에 가공제 피복물을 지니는 신장 파열된 유리섬유들의 접착성 슬라이버(여기에서, 가공제는 점성윤활제와 대전방지 성분의 혼합물을 함유하며, 상기 슬라이버는 데니어당 0.01g 이상의 접착력을 지닌다).
  2. 그 위에 가공제 피복물을 지니는 신장 파열된 탄소섬유들의 접착성 슬라이버(여기에서, 가공제는 점성윤활제와 대전방지 성분의 혼합물을 함유하며, 상기 슬라이버는 데니어당 0.01g 이상의 접착력을 지닌다).
  3. 제1항에 있어서, 상기 가공제가 C8-C12포스페이트 에스테르의 디에탄올아민 1부와 폴리에틸렌 글리콜 모노라우레이트 및 라우르산 아미드 2부의 혼합물을 함유하는 슬라이버.
  4. 제2항에 있어서, 상기 가공제가 폴리에틸렌 글리콜 모노라우레이트 및 라우랄 아드를 함유하는 슬라이버.
  5. 제1항 내지 4항중 어느 한 항에 있어서, 슬라이버 상의 가공제 백분율이 약 0.3 내지 약 0.5%인 슬라이버.
  6. 평균길이가 0.50인치 이상인 실질적으로 축상으로 배열된 탄소 스테이플 섬유의 슬라이버르 보강된 매트릭스 수지 층을 함유하는 복합품.
  7. 평균길이가 0.50인치 이상인 실질적으로 축상으로 배열된 유리 스테이플 섬유의 슬라이버르 보강된 매트릭스 수지 층을 함유하는 복합품.
  8. 제6항 또는 7항에 있어서, 섬유의 약 85%가 축방향의 ±10°이내로 배열된 복합품.
  9. 제6항, 7항 또는 8항에 있어서, 상기 섬유의 평균길이가 약 1/2인치 내지 약 6인치 범위인 복합품.
  10. 제6항, 7항, 8항 또는 9항에 있어서, 상기 합성물의 고온인장신도가 파열없이 약 50% 이하인 복합품.
  11. 제6항, 7항, 8항, 9항 또는 10항에 있어서, 섬유가 복합품의 40용적% 내지 약 75용적%를 차지하는 복합품.
  12. 제6항, 7항, 8항, 9항, 10항 또는 제11항에 있어서, 매트릭스가 열가소성 수지인 복합품.
  13. 제6항, 7항, 8항, 9항, 10항 또는 제11항에 있어서, 매트릭스가 열경화성 수지인 복합품.
  14. 제6항, 7항, 8항, 9항, 10항 또는 제11항에 있어서, 매트릭스가 에폭시수지인 복합품.
  15. 제6항 또는 7항에 있어서, 몇개의 층이 서로에 대해 상쇄된 다수의 층이 존재하는 복합품.
  16. 연속 필라멘트의 사 또는 토우(tow)를 인장영역으로 공급하고, 이 필라멘트를 불규칙적으로 파열시키는 파열장력으로 인장시키는 단계를 포함하는, 신장 파열된 섬유의 슬라이버를 제조하는 방법에 있어서, 유리 섬유의 사 또는 토우를 인장영역으로 공급하고, 인장된 필라멘트를 파열시키기 전에 C8-C12포스페이트 에스테르의 디에탄올 아민염 1부 및 폴리에틸렌 글리콜 모노라우레이트 및 라우르산아미드 2부의 혼합물을 함유하는 가공제를 적용시킴을 특징으로 하는 방법.
  17. 연속필라멘트의 사 또는 토우를 인장영역으로 공급하고 이 필라멘트를 파열시키는 파열장력으로 인장시키는 단계를 포함하는, 신장파열된 섬유의 슬라이버를 제조하는 방법에 있어서, 탄소 섬유의 사 또는 토우를 상기 인장영역으로 공급하고, 폴리에틸렌 글리콜 모노라우레이트 및 라우르산 아미드를 함유하는 가공제를 적용시킴을 특징으로 하는 방법.
